A Story for Friday...

So this morning, I'm on my way to work. I'm thinking, today is a good day I like today. I get off the skytrain come up the long escalator at Granville head up the stairs towards the exit to Granville Street. I open the door and look back to courtiously hold it for the guy behind me, he says "Thanks man!" as he goes by and I smile, today is a good day.

Then I turn around to continue my happy journey to work and I knock over a 4 year old girl, face first into the gross grimy cement at the entrance to the Granville Skytrain station. She starts screaming, I just stand there and say "Oh my god, are you ok?!" Her mom who was a couple feet behind her comes running over, and I'm like crap! "I'm so sorry about that, I didn't see her!" The nice mom says it's ok it's not your fault. And all I could do was say I'm sorry and this little girl is screaming her head off. I look up from the scene I have just created and there are those stupid 24 newspaper handout people staring at me like I just punched her in the face. So I slink past them head down, grabbing a paper as I go by just to seem like I really am a nice guy, and don't often go around knocking little girls to the gross slimy cement at skytrain stations.

That all being said, as I see it, I probably scored that little girl a free icecream or lolipop from her mom to make her feel better. So really I think that little girl should be thanking me...right...right??

...I feel like a huge jerk...
